What is a photomath camera calculator app?

A photomath camera calculator app uses optical character recognition (OCR) to interpret a math problem from a live camera view or a captured image. It then applies symbolic computation to generate the solution, typically showing step-by-step explanations. The name “photomath” has become a generic term for this type of tool, even though it is also associated with a specific brand. At its core, the technology performs three tasks: capture, interpret, and solve. The capture stage uses your device camera to detect the equation. The interpret stage turns visual symbols into machine-readable math expressions. The solve stage applies algorithms to find the answer and produce a walkthrough.

This workflow differs significantly from a standard calculator. Traditional calculators rely on manual input and provide a numeric result. Camera-based calculators can read printed or handwritten equations and expand the answer into a sequence of steps. This makes them useful for concept reinforcement, especially for learners who need to see how to move from one transformation to the next. When used properly, the app becomes a tutor, not just a shortcut.

Downloading safely: official stores and trusted sources

The safest way to download a photomath camera calculator app is through official marketplaces—Google Play on Android or the App Store on iOS. These stores provide reviews, permission transparency, and automatic updates. Avoid third-party APK sites or sideloaded versions unless you are experienced in mobile security and have a clear reason to do so. In an educational context, safety and reliability should be the top priorities.

Below is a simple comparison table that highlights the differences between common download sources and the risk level associated with each:

Download Source Security Checks Update Reliability Recommended For
Official App Store / Google Play High (automatic scans) Automatic and frequent Most users, students, and parents
Device Manufacturer Store Moderate to high Moderate Users in regions with limited access
Third-Party APK Sites Low or inconsistent Manual updates Advanced users only

Device requirements and performance considerations

Camera calculator apps typically require a modern smartphone with a decent camera and sufficient memory. OCR accuracy improves with higher camera resolution and adequate lighting. If a device is older, the app may still work, but recognition might be slower or inaccurate. Storage is another consideration: while the app itself may be modest in size, it might download offline equation packs or cache images. If your device has limited storage, choose a “lite” mode or clear the app cache periodically.

Device Factor Recommended Minimum Impact on Experience
Camera Resolution 8 MP or higher Higher clarity for OCR accuracy
RAM 3 GB or higher Smoother image processing and faster load time
Storage 500 MB free Space for caches and offline data
OS Version Android 8+ or iOS 13+ Compatibility and security updates

Educational benefits: beyond the answer

Critics often claim that camera calculator apps promote dependency. However, when used with intent, these tools can enhance conceptual understanding. The key is to use the app as a lens to see the path, not as an escape from the work. Step-by-step breakdowns can reveal algebraic transformations, clarify order of operations, and demonstrate solution strategies. For students who struggle with math anxiety, seeing a solution pathway can reduce stress and improve confidence.

Teachers can also leverage these apps by focusing on the reasoning rather than the final answer. For example, an educator can assign tasks that require students to compare two different solution paths or identify which step corrects a misunderstanding. Parents can use the app to guide homework sessions by asking their child to explain each step. In a study routine, the app becomes a resource similar to a textbook example but more accessible and tailored to the student’s specific problem.

Responsible use and academic integrity

Responsible use is essential. Educational institutions have different policies on calculator apps, and students should always follow classroom guidelines. The goal is not to circumvent learning but to support it. For integrity guidance, consult resources like the U.S. Department of Education at ed.gov and research on academic performance from the National Center for Education Statistics at nces.ed.gov. These sources provide context on standards, learning outcomes, and the role of technology in education.

In practice, you can create a personal rule set. Use the app after you attempt the problem on your own. Then compare your approach with the app’s steps. Finally, rewrite the solution in your own words. This method converts the app into a feedback loop rather than a shortcut. Many students also use the app for error checking during exam prep, which helps them locate patterns of mistakes and build stronger intuition.

Optimizing your workflow after download

Once you download a photomath camera calculator app, optimize its benefits by building a consistent routine. Start with warm-up problems that you solve manually, then use the camera feature to verify. Keep a notebook for “before and after” notes: write your solution, then note the difference between your steps and the app’s solution. Over time, this creates a personalized catalog of misconceptions and learning targets.

Additionally, set time boundaries. It can be tempting to scan every problem, but passive scanning reduces retention. Use the app as a tool for clarification, not as a default pathway. Students preparing for standardized tests can allocate specific sessions for app-assisted practice and others for independent work. This balance reinforces both accuracy and confidence.

Privacy and permissions

Because these apps rely on the camera, they will request permission to access it. Grant only the permissions necessary for core functionality. Avoid apps that request unusual permissions like access to contacts or SMS unless there is a clear and transparent reason. If you are a parent, consider configuring device-level controls or reviewing permission settings with your child.
